The Supreme Court upheld the constitutional validity of a cess levied on sugar cane by the erstwhile Ruler of Gwalior State under Article 265 of the Constitution of India, affirming that the order dated 27-7-1946 constituted a law enacted by the Ruler and thus was valid post-1950. The Court found that the levy did not violate Article 14, as it aimed at cane development and was based on permissible geographical classification. The ruling followed the precedent set in Madhaorao Phalke v. The State of Madhya Bharat, [1961] 1 S.C.R. 957.
